I had the Auto Ventshade Vent Visors on my car first, then I took em off and replaced them with the Weathertechs because I didnt like how the vent visors covered up some of the chrome trim. I had my vent visors on for like 2 years and just took em off in the spring and there was barely any marks. When you first take them off there will still be some of the tape adhesive on the chrome, but I just cleaned it all up. There is still some marks on the pillars but they should wear away and they might even clean up, I havent tried anything on them yet.
